## Event Schema Registry

Welcome aboard! All events flowing through Driftbus must have a schema registered in Schemakeep first — no schema, no publish. Versioning is append-only; breaking changes need a new subject. The registry itself is tiny, just one Postgres instance behind it. To browse registered schemas directly, connect with the following.

replica DSN, kajep-yahag: mssql://praok_svc:iF@db-8d68.plorvaio.local:5432/eliion

**Mgmt Meeting Minutes — Retiring the Brightline Range**

Quick recap for sales leads at Fenholt Supplies: we agreed to retire the Brightline fixture range by year-end. Remaining stock moves to clearance pricing next month, and accounts on standing orders get migrated to the Lumetta range. Trade-in incentives were approved in principle. The confidential note on next steps sits just below.

board note of bajof-bajeg: The pricing group signed off on a budget of $13.4 million for Project Sildor. The renewal with Lamixek Holdings closes at $48.9 million a year, 49 percent above the last contract.

Action item PM-7 (Ledgervine outage, severity 2): refactor the legacy ORM layer that caused the connection-pool exhaustion. Until the refactor ships, support should expect occasional slow queries on account-history lookups during month-end batch runs. Workarounds: advise customers to retry after two minutes, and tag affected tickets with the ORM-legacy label so engineering can track frequency. Progress, known-affected endpoints, and the rollout timeline are maintained on the page below.

runbook for badug-kadup: https://confluence.zemvarlabs.internal/projects/browse/display/projects/bd1b

Handover — Torv to Ilse (Quennel broker upgrade)

Upgrading Mistrel broker cluster from 4.2 to 5.0 this week. Support impact: brief reconnect storms during rolling restarts, expected under two minutes per node. Consumers auto-retry; no tickets needed unless lag exceeds 10 min. Rollback snapshot stored in the Harbrook vault. If you must roll back before I'm reachable, the vault recovery passphrase follows.

unlock words, hahip-baduf: holwyn-istath-julvan